Kaidah-kaidah metode ilmiah : panduan untuk penelitian dan critical thinking
Pengantar sains data
Model integrasi sains dan Islam
Islamic sciences : astronomy, cosmology and geometry
Al-Qur'an berbicara tentang akal dan ilmu pengetahuan
Revolusi saintifik Iran
Contemporary debates in philosophy of science
The Oxford companion to the history of modern science
Novitas Mundi : perception of the history of being
Science : as seen through the development of scientific instrument